WWE continues to shake up its roster as Luke Gallows and Karl Anderson have reportedly been released from the company on February 8. Fans are left wondering what this means for the future of The OC and the tag team division. With their storied careers, will we see them back in the ring soon?

This News follows their return to WWE in 2022 after being released during the pandemic. Despite their impressive track record, including two Raw Tag Team title reigns, they struggled to find their footing in recent months.

Impact of Gallows and Anderson’s Departure on WWE Tag Teams

The exit of Gallows and Anderson could have serious implications for WWE’s tag team division. Their experience and popularity made them key players. Here are some key points to consider:

  • Two-time Raw Tag Team Champions with a strong fan base.
  • Struggled to gain traction in recent months, including a loss in NXT.
  • Part of the legendary Bullet Club in New Japan Pro-Wrestling.
  • Join a list of notable releases, including Cedric Alexander and Sonya Deville.
